Shooting with a Soft Focus Effect

This function allows you to shoot images as if a soft focus filter were
attached to the camera. You can adjust the effect level as desired.

Shooting in Monochrome

Still Images
Movies
Shoot images in black and white, sepia, or blue and white.

B/W
Black and white shots.
Sepia
Sepia tone shots.
Blue
Blue and white shots.
